If you have doubts about the client consuming all ur computing powah :

The results of our testing couldn't be clearer, at least for the systems we've tested today. Quite simply, the impact of running Folding@Home in the background is negligible. Even the most discerning users won't notice it. Windows allocates CPU time slices according to process priority, and as long as the Folding@Home client is running as an idle-priority task (which is how it runs by default), one shouldn't notice any slowdown.

a) if you finished a packet (wu) it takes an hour or two before you can see it at : http://folding.stanford.edu/cgi-bin/...etailed?q=3365
Then it takes another four to six hours before you can see the result at : http://www.statsman.org/folding2stats/3365.html
The latter is easier to compare with as you can sort on the different colums or select rows and create a chart of them.
